Tongji University

Shanghai Shi, China

Tongji University was established in the early twentieth century in Shanghai by the German government. Tongji University is especially renowned for its engineering, business and architecture programs; its civil engineering department has consistently ranked first in China for decades.

Step-by-Step Guide to Admission Requirements at Tongji University

General Requirements:

Age: Applicants must be at least 18 years old.

Citizenship: Must be a non-Chinese citizen.

Education: Applicants must have completed high school or its equivalent.

Health: Applicants must be in good health.

Language Proficiency:

HSK (Chinese Proficiency Test):

HSK Level 4 is generally required for Science and Engineering programs, with a minimum score of 180.

HSK Level 5 may be required for programs like Architecture, Management & Economics, and Medicine, with a minimum score of 200.

BA in Chinese Language or other specialized programs may have specific HSK level requirements.

Other Language Proficiency:

For programs taught in English, applicants may need to demonstrate English proficiency through standardized tests like TOEFL or IELTS.

Application Materials:

Application Form: Complete and submit the official application form provided by the university.

Passport: Submit a copy of the personal information page of your passport.

High School Diploma/Certificate: Provide a copy of your high school diploma or certificate of expected graduation. If not in Chinese or English, submit a notarized translation.

Transcripts: Submit original or notarized transcripts from your high school, detailing all courses taken. If not in Chinese or English, include a notarized translation.

HSK Certificate: Provide a copy of your HSK certificate, showing the required level and score.

Other Materials: Depending on the program and your specific situation, additional documents may be required, including:

Certificate of Payment for the registration fee.

Personal Statement written in the language of instruction for your program.

Physical Examination Form for Foreigners (completed within the last six months) or a valid Chinese visa.

Tongji University Corporate Partnership

  • World Intellectual Property Organization (WIPO) : WIPO is a global organization that promotes and protects intellectual property (IP) rights across the world. Tongji University collaborates with WIPO on research, education, and training in IP law and policy.
  • National Intellectual Property Administration, PRC : This is China’s top agency for managing patents, trademarks, and copyrights. The partnership supports joint initiatives in IP development, legal reform, and innovation strategies.
  • Shanghai High People’s Court : One of the highest judicial authorities in Shanghai, it plays a key role in adjudicating IP and commercial disputes. Tongji works with the court to deepen understanding of IP law enforcement and case studies.
  • Ludwig-Maximilians-University Munich : One of Europe’s premier universities, LMU Munich partners with Tongji to advance comparative legal research. They also facilitate faculty and student exchanges, especially in the legal sciences.
  • Leibniz Universität Hannover : Known for its expertise in law and engineering, this university supports collaborative research and dual-degree programs. The partnership strengthens legal and technical education between China and Germany.
  • Humboldt-Universität zu Berlin : This prestigious university contributes to interdisciplinary research, especially in law and social sciences. Tongji’s partnership fosters academic workshops, lectures, and bilateral research projects.
  • Fachbereich Rechtswissenschaft (Law Department) : As the law faculty of a German university, it offers expertise in comparative legal systems. Their collaboration with Tongji enriches legal scholarship and cross-border curriculum development.

Notable Achievements of Tongji University

Achievements

01.
The "Two Transforms" Policy

In 1978, Tongji embraced China's reform era with the "two transforms" policy, which revitalized its academic landscape. The university strengthened international ties, especially with Germany, and expanded into a multidisciplinary engineering powerhouse.

Year
1978
02.
Post-1952 Restructuring

After China’s national higher education reorganization in 1952, Tongji sharpened its focus on engineering. It became especially renowned for civil engineering and architecture, laying the groundwork for its technical prestige.

Year
1952
03.
Establishment and Early Development

Founded in 1912 as the German-Chinese University of Engineering, Tongji quickly established itself with strong programs in natural sciences, engineering, and medicine. It earned early recognition as a leading comprehensive university in China.

Year
1912
